Another note to people who would like to use TRK from UBCD: the problem described by me is indeed known. For TRK3.2 the solution is to rename your USB stick to TRK_3-2. For TRK3.3 you can either rename it to TRK_3-3, or use a new feature available in TRK3.3: add the option vollabel=YOURLABEL to all ...
